Established in 2003 Tan Phu District is a bustling area in Ho Chi Minh City. It wasn’t always this vibrant place. Before becoming a district it was a small commune. Imagine a quiet rural area transformed into a modern district. This incredible change happened in just a few decades. Tan Phu District covers 15.97 square kilometers. It’s home to almost half a million people. That’s a lot of people living and working together.
Tan Phu District borders several other districts. Tan Binh District lies to the east. Binh Tan District is to the west. Districts 6 and 11 are to the south. Finally District 12 is to the north. Its central location makes it an important part of the city. Its position allows easy access to many other areas.
The district is divided into eleven wards. Each ward has its own unique character. Tay Thanh Ward for example was home to almost 38000 people in 2004. Tan Son Nhi Ward was smaller with a population of about 25000. The other wards have their own distinct identities and histories. This shows how the population has grown since 2004.
Tan Phu isn’t just about administrative boundaries. It’s also a place of lively markets. Aeon Mall Tan Phu is a huge shopping center. It’s a popular destination for families. The mall houses over 200 stores. You’ll find everything from clothes to electronics. Pandora Shopping Mall offers another shopping experience. This place has a cinema and even a swimming pool. Beyond shopping you can also find family-friendly entertainment. Chu Voi Con Playground provides a safe environment for children to play. TiniWorld Tan Phu is another fun place for kids. This play area has zones themed around different activities. You will find areas focused on physical activities and cognitive development.
Food lovers will find a culinary paradise in Tan Phu District. You can enjoy local dishes like Kiểu Bảo Grilled Pork Vermicelli. This is a popular place known for its delicious pork. Ba Khum’s Clean Intestine Stew is another local favorite. For seafood you can try Ốc nhồi Sài Gòn. This restaurant offers a variety of seafood dishes. They are made using fresh ingredients.
